Preparing the appliance for first use

Notes

  • Perform the first cleaning process with a mixture of 5 cups of water and 1 cup of vinegar.
  • Before each rinsing process switch off the appliance using the on/off button and leave it to cool down for 5 minutes.
  • Run the rinsing process twice using 6 cups of water without adding vinegar.

General information

  • Observe the water level indicator on the water tank. Fill the water tank to at least the bottom marking line and no more than the top marking line.
  • To attain an adequate coffee temperature and the full aroma, do not brew less than 3 cups of coffee. A cup is approx. 125 ml.
  • Add approx. 6 g medium-ground coffee for each cup.
  • Store ground coffee in a cool place or freeze.
  • Once a pack of coffee has been opened, always close it tightly to preserve the aroma.
  • How coffee beans are roasted affects their flavour and aroma.
    • Darker roast = more flavour
    • Lighter roast = more acidity
  • Condensation may form on the filter housing for technical reasons.

Auto switch-off

Your appliance is equipped with an automatic switch-off function that switches the appliance off after a certain period of time. Models with a thermos jug switch off a few minutes after the end of brewing. Models with a glass jug keep the coffee hot for approx. 40 minutes and then switch off.
The on/off button lights up red until the cof-fee machine switches off automatically.

Thermos jug
The thermos jug has a capacity of around 8 cups.

Notes

  • The seal is not hermetically tight to stop it adhering through a suction effect.
  • Never transport the thermos jug in a horizontal position or coffee might leak out.
  • Do not keep or transport carbonated drinks in the thermos jug.
  • If you rinse the thermos jug with hot water before use, the coffee will stay hot for longer.

Descaling the appliance

Descale the appliance regularly.

Notes

  • Descale the appliance immediately when:
    • brewing takes longer
    • excessive steam is emitted

the appliance makes more noise

  • Regular descaling:
    • prolongs the life of the appliance
    • ensures proper functioning
    • prevents excessive steam
    • shortens the brewing time
    • saves energy
  • If you are descaling the appliance with a commercially available descaler, follow the manufacturer’s instructions for use and safety. Do not use descaler with phosphoric acid.
  • If the appliance is brewing more slowly or switches off before the brewing process ends, descale it.
  • If there is still fluid in the water tank after 3 descaling cycles, switch the appliance on again until the water tank is empty, wait 1 minute and then switch off.

Overview of cleaning

  • Do not use cleaning agents containing alcohol or spirits.
  • Do not use sharp, pointed or metal objects.
  • Do not use abrasive cloths or cleaning agents. Fig. 27BOSCH-TKA2M113-Filter-Coffee-Machine-fig12

Notes

  • After each use, clean all parts thoroughly and rinse out.
  • Remove stubborn deposits in the thermos jug with a solution of baking soda, dishwasher granulate or denture tablets.
  • Store the thermos jug with the lid open to prevent any odours and bacteria forming.
  • If the drip stop is leaking:
    • Remove the filter holder and clean the drip stop under running water.
    • Press the drip stop towards the filter holder with your finger several times.
